Idea:, VMs choose a spec level for run #108
Open
Description
Problem statement: I want to use WebAssembly compliant with specification X.Y.
Suggestion:
- Store spec version the operator was introduced in the
operators.Op
structure, add to existing new*Op() functions - When disassembly happens, opcodes present before the spec version cause an error.
- Change the
ReadModule
orDecodeModule
function to take a new argument representing the spec version.
I don't think the working group are intending on supporting any non-backwards-compatible proposals, but in the event they do, we can load a different vm. method into vm.funcTable
to do the different feature without any performance hit. (that said, this is not likely to ever happen according to the footnote here)
Thoughts?
A good testbed on this might be the sign-extension-ops proposal.
